Description

If youre passionate about programming and want to get better at it, youve come to the right source. Code Craft author Pete Goodliffe presents a collection of useful techniques and approaches to the art and craft of programming that will help boost your career and your well-being.

Goodliffe presents sound advice that hes learned in 15 years of professional programming. The books standalone chapters span the range of a software developers lifedealing with code, learning the trade, and improving performancewith no language or industry bias. Whether youre a seasoned developer, a neophyte professional, or a hobbyist, youll find valuable tips in five independent categories:

  • Code-level techniques for crafting lines of code, testing, debugging, and coping with complexity
  • Practices, approaches, and attitudes: keep it simple, collaborate well, reuse, and create malleable code
  • Tactics for learning effectively, behaving ethically, finding challenges, and avoiding stagnation
  • Practical ways to complete things: use the right tools, know what done looks like, and seek help from colleagues
  • Habits for working well with others, and pursuing development as a social activity
